Today we welcomed Minister for Education, Ms. Norma Foley T.D. to Coláiste Iascaigh to officially open the school extension. This was an incredible day from beginning to end. The student council greeted Minister Foley and brought her to the school courtyard where all school members and invited guests were gathered and enjoyed some superb traditional music played by some of our students. Cathaoirleach Councillor Michael Clarke welcomed Minister Foley to the school. Speakers at the event included MSLETB Chair Cllr Mary Bohan, MSLETB Chief Executive Tom Grady, Minister Norma Foley and School Principal Mr. Coggins concluded the event. Student council representatives presented Minister Foley with a beautiful piece of local pottery and flowers, thanking her for her visit to the school. The Minister visited classrooms and engaged with the students, discussing teaching and learning at Coláiste Iascaigh. Before leaving, Minister Foley raised The Green Schools Flag with the help of the Green Schools Committee and expressed her delight to visit the Marine Ambassador School of the year.
